I also heard that it is in the area of 1$ per 1000 views, but varies greatly.

Anyways, if you have a few thousand views a day, you could end up making some money off of it. If you only have a hundred views per day (like me), the 3 bucks each month in my opinion don't make up for the 5 second ad the viewers have to sit through to get to your content.

I think you really have to balance the money you make from it versus the annoyance of your viewership. I never turned on any ads, since when I send friends a link, I don't want them to watch an ad first. I'd rather have them pay me the 0.1 cents directly. :)

Honestly, it's a lot of work and depending on your subject matter it can cost more than you make back from AdSense. You also need to become a YouTube partner before you start making any money from them.

It also depends on the popularity of the video and the time of the year. During Christmas was the best of the year more me and AdSense revenue, now it's just depressing making nearly 33% of what I made from AdSense during Christmas.
